Celtic chase former £10m Nottingham Forest striker Emmanuel Dennis
Stephen McGowan says Celtic are looking to sign Nigerian international striker Emmanuel Dennis.
The 27-year-old was freed by Nottingham Forest last month and it appears that Celtic are looking to make him the 13th signing of the summer.
McGowan writes in The Herald that as well as Celtic looking at Patrick Bamford, the Parkhead club are also believed to be looking at Dennis too.
The striker is still searching for a new club and it appears that Parkhead could be a possible destination.
Emmanuel Dennis’ impressive league title-winning credentials could make him perfect for Celtic
Dennis has experience of winning titles before with Champions League side Club Brugge.
The striker won three titles in Belgium over a four-year spell in 2018, 2020 and 2021.
However, in 116 appearances, Dennis only managed to score 29 goals and provide 13 assists.
Out of his 247 career appearances over seven different clubs, Dennis has scored 52 goals and provided 25 assists.
